What is the DME Ancillary Services Authorization Request?
The DME Ancillary Services Authorization Request is a critical form used in the healthcare system to facilitate the process of obtaining durable medical equipment (DME). Durable medical equipment refers to devices that provide therapeutic benefits to patients, such as wheelchairs or oxygen tanks. This form requires essential information, including details about the member, the provider, the specific service requested, and a clinical summary.
This authorization request plays a vital role in ensuring that healthcare providers receive appropriate claims payment. By providing accurate information, the form helps notify servicing providers of the patient's needs efficiently.

What are the eligibility requirements for submitting this form?
To submit the DME Ancillary Services Authorization Request form, the healthcare provider must be authorized to provide DME services, and the patient must have valid insurance coverage for such services.
Is there a deadline for submitting the DME authorization request?
It is recommended to submit the DME Ancillary Services Authorization Request form as soon as the need for equipment arises, to prevent delays in service provision and claims processing.
How can I submit the completed authorization request?
You can submit the completed DME Ancillary Services Authorization Request form through your insurance provider’s online portal, by fax, or by mail, depending on the requirements of the specific insurance company.
What supporting documents are required with this form?
Typically, you will need to include clinical notes justifying the DME request, any previous medical records that support the need, and possibly a prescription from a physician.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ling this form?
Ensure all required fields are completed with accurate information and double-check for typos. A common mistake is omitting the clinical summary or providing insufficient detail.
What are the expected processing times for this authorization request?
Processing times can vary by insurer; however, most requests are reviewed within 5-14 business days. Check with the specific insurer for their timelines.
